Stocks Ended Sharply Lower, Dow below 20,000

Stocks ended sharply lower on Wednesday, with the Dow Jones Industrial Average finishing below 20,000 level, as worldwide cases of the coronavirus soaring above 200,000. The Dow Jones Industrial Average dropped 1,338.46 points, or 6.30%, to 19,898.92. The S&P 500 fell 131.09 points, or 5.18%, to 2,398.10. The Nasdaq Composite lost 344.94 points, or 4.70%, to 6,989.84.

Oil futures extended their plunge Wednesday, sending U.S. prices to their lowest finish since 2002. West Texas Intermediate crude for April delivery fell $6.58, or more than 24%, to settle at $20.37 a barrel. May Brent crude dropped $3.85, or over 13%, at $24.88 a barrel.
